Current Form and Team News

As of this writing, Millwall resides in a mid-table position in the EFL Championship, having shown signs of inconsistency this season. Their squad, featuring the likes of striker Tom Bradshaw and captain Jake Cooper, remains a formidable presence, especially at their home ground, The Den. In their recent outing, Millwall managed a draw against a top-tier side, showcasing their resilience and capability to compete against stronger opponents.

On the other hand, Ipswich Town is enjoying a more promising season after their promotion from League One. Their current form has seen them climb the rankings, and they bring a wave of confidence into the fixture, buoyed by key performances from players such as Wes Burns and Conor Chaplin. However, the team is dealing with injury concerns, particularly to their defensive ranks, which could severely impact their performance against a robust attack like Millwall’s.

Head to Head Record

Historically, matches between Millwall and Ipswich Town have been closely contested. In their last five encounters, both teams have recorded two wins each, with one match ending in a draw. The most recent match-up at Portman Road saw Ipswich narrowly edge out Millwall, which adds further motivation for the Lions to reclaim local pride in this upcoming game.
